Cedar Creek Village is a charming community located in Cedar Creek, NE. They offer a range of amenities and services, including a village office, meeting minutes, ordinances, public notices, regulations, forms, recycling, and a newsletter. The village also boasts a strong sense of community, with events such as the VFD Auxiliary Pancake Breakfast and the Annual Meeting Volunteer Recognition Event and Chili Cookoff.

For those who enjoy music and dancing, Cedar Creek Village is home to the Cornhusker Country Music Theater, where visitors can enjoy jam sessions, live performances, and family-friendly entertainment. Additionally, the village hosts a food bank, blood drives, and encourages local volunteerism. Municipal Housing Agency

The Municipal Housing Agency (MHA) was created in 1968 to serve as the public housing authority within the city limits of Council Bluffs. MHA currently assists families and individuals who are disabled, near-elderly, elderly or low-income. Regal Towers and Dudley Court provide 295 units of public housing and our Section 8 Housing Choice Voucher Program provides approximately 650 vouchers. The Municipal Housing Agency Board of Commissioners is appointed by the Council Bluffs Mayor, Tom Hanafan. The board is comprised of five board members who serve staggered two-year terms. Meetings are held the second Thursday of every month at Regal Towers. Municipal Housing Agency Board of Commissioners Municipal Housing Agency has been under the direction of Carolyn Grieder since May, 2009. Carolyn has ten years experience in the public housing sector and over 36 years of employment with various government entities. Carolyn oversees an annual budget of 6.5 million dollars. Her responsibilities include administering HUD grants and subsidies, staff management, capital improvements, program development, property management and the Section 8 program. Carolyn is also Director of Municipal Homes Inc, the agency's non profit organization.
